Unexpected expenses are a regular part of everyday life especially if you’re just getting back from active duty, or even if you’re still serving- because life doesn’t stop and wait for you back home and you’ve got a family to look after.

Personal Loans a fantastic tool to help you overcome those pesky problems and expenses that can crop up every now and then-

If you owe a lot on your credit cards, high balances on multiple cards, they’re probably burning a hole in your pocket with the interest payments, and it more than likely that they’re lowering your credit score as well. Using a personal loan to pay off your credit cards is a process known as debt consolidation, it basically lets you simplify multiple bills into one, reduces your interest charges and improves your credit score.

If you have an important personal event that you’re planning  like a wedding or an important anniversary or sadly in some cases a funeral. A personal loan can provide a good chunk of cash to help with payments for caterers, florists, venue rentals, etc.

Got a home improvement project planned? Making a major improvement to your home, such as  remodelling your kitchen or redoing your master bathroom, then the best financing option is often a personal loan especially if you prefer not to use your home as collateral while taking out a home equity line of credit (HELOC).

Imagine your furnace just stops working or your laptop just went into sleep mode only to never wake again or roof spouts a leak that’ll cost entirely too much to fix. Now consider medical emergencies: An injury or illness that costs more than your full annual deductible in one payment could overtax your credit cards, and related expenses that aren’t covered by your insurance can pile up fast. A personal loan can help you manage these emergency expenses and take some stress out of these situations.
